Hendley, NE Frost Dates & Growing Season
Last Spring Frost Date for Hendley, NE
The average last frost date in spring for Hendley is May 2nd. For gardeners planting sensitive crops like tomatoes, peppers, and basil, it is generally recommended to wait until May 16th before moving plants outdoors. Waiting these extra few weeks significantly reduces the risk of a late freeze damaging young transplants.
First Fall Frost Date for Hendley, NE
The average first frost date in fall for Hendley is October 6th. This date marks the approximate end of the growing season for tender plants. Gardeners should plan to harvest frost-sensitive vegetables or provide heavy protection (such as row covers) before this date to avoid crop loss.
Growing Season Length in Hendley, NE
Based on historical frost data, the estimated growing season length in Hendley is approximately 157 days. This duration determines which vegetable varieties have enough time to reach maturity before the winter cold sets in. Short-season varieties are recommended for crops that require a longer warm period.
Please note: These dates are climatological averages. Actual weather conditions vary by year. Always check the local 10-day forecast before planting.
